Latest Patents

One of Shishido's latest patents is the "Mount Shift Apparatus of Lens for CCTV Camera." This invention features a mount frame equipped with a threaded portion that can be screw-engaged by a camera body mount. It includes a lens frame that supports a photographing lens group, allowing for movement relative to the mount frame in a direction perpendicular to the optical axis. Additionally, a mount shift device is incorporated to adjust the lens frame's position accordingly. Another notable patent is the "ND Filter," which involves a concentric ND filter design. This design consists of multi-layered circular ND filter elements that decrease in diameter stepwise, arranged on a transparent substrate. The surrounding space is filled with a transparent adhesive, enhancing the filter's performance.
